How Many Wears Are Acceptable?

So, how many wears should your pajamas endure before they deserve a spin in the washing machine? Well, it’s not a one-size-fits-all answer. The ideal number of wears can vary depending on several factors:

Fabric Type: The type of fabric your pajamas are made from matters. Natural materials like cotton and bamboo tend to be more breathable and forgiving, while synthetics may trap sweat and odor more quickly.

Personal Comfort: Some people have more sensitive skin or might sweat more at night. These factors can influence how often you should wash your pajamas.

Environmental Considerations: Washing clothes consumes water and energy. If you’re conscious of your environmental impact, you might lean towards wearing your pajamas a few times before washing them.

The Case for Regular Pajama Washing

Now, let’s discuss why it’s essential to wash your pajamas regularly:

Hygiene: Our bodies naturally shed skin cells and produce sweat while we sleep. This can create a breeding ground for bacteria if you don’t wash your pajamas often enough. Regular washing helps maintain better hygiene.

Odor Control: Nobody likes to wake up to the smell of stale sweat. Washing your pajamas regularly keeps them smelling fresh and inviting.

Skin Health: Wearing dirty pajamas can lead to skin issues like acne or irritation. Clean sleepwear can help prevent these problems.

Comfort: Freshly laundered pajamas just feel better. They’re softer and more comfortable to wear, contributing to a better night’s sleep.

Finding Your Pajama Washing Frequency

In the end, there’s no one-size-fits-all answer to the age-old question of how often you should wash your pajamas. It’s a personal choice influenced by factors like fabric, personal comfort, and environmental concerns.

However, a general rule of thumb is to aim for washing your pajamas after 3-4 wears. This should strike a balance between maintaining hygiene and conserving resources. Of course, if your pajamas become visibly soiled or you experience discomfort, don’t hesitate to throw them in the laundry sooner.
